Biao Luo is a scholar working on Computational Theory and Mathematics, Control and Systems Engineering and Artificial Intelligence. According to data from OpenAlex, Biao Luo has authored 153 papers receiving a total of 4.7k indexed citations (citations by other indexed papers that have themselves been cited), including 59 papers in Computational Theory and Mathematics, 54 papers in Control and Systems Engineering and 39 papers in Artificial Intelligence. Recurrent topics in Biao Luo's work include Adaptive Dynamic Programming Control (52 papers), Reinforcement Learning in Robotics (24 papers) and Adaptive Control of Nonlinear Systems (22 papers). Biao Luo is often cited by papers focused on Adaptive Dynamic Programming Control (52 papers), Reinforcement Learning in Robotics (24 papers) and Adaptive Control of Nonlinear Systems (22 papers). Biao Luo collaborates with scholars based in China, United States and Qatar. Biao Luo's co-authors include Derong Liu, Huai‐Ning Wu, Tingwen Huang, Shan Xue, Ding Wang, Qinglai Wei, Bo Zhao, Yin Yang, Xiong Yang and Yueheng Li and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Genes & Development and Applied Physics Letters.
